2.1  
Operation  
Fuel vapours form over the fuel surface on the tank, depending  
on the atmospheric pressure and ambient temperature.  
The activated charcoal filter prevents these hydrocarbon emis‐  
sions from being released into the atmosphere.  
The fuel vapours coming from the highest point of the tank go  
through the gravity valve (which closes at a 45° inclination) and  
check valve, strangled in its amount, to the activated charcoal  
filter.  
The activated charcoal absorbs these vapours like a sponge.  
While driving and with Lambda adjustment active (hot engine),  
the electromagnetic valve 1 for activated charcoal filter system -  
N80- , (also known as regeneration valve) is activated cyclically  
by the Engine control unit -J623- , due to engine speed and load.  
The opening period depends on the input signals.  
Intake manifold vacuum aspirates fresh air through the vent open‐  
ing on the lower part of the activated charcoal filter, during the  
activated charcoal regeneration process. The fuel vapours stored  
in the activated charcoal and the fresh air are fed for combustion  
in dosed quantities.  
The pressure retention valve prevents the fuel vapours from being  
aspirated into the fuel reservoir, when the Magnetic valve I for  
activated charcoal filter -N80- is opened and there is vacuum in  
the intake manifold. This way, the activated charcoal filter regen‐  
eration is ensured.  
With no current (e.g., driver interruption) the Magnetic valve 1 for  
activated charcoal filter -N80- remains closed. The activated char‐  
coal filter will not be purged.

2.3  
Reservoir ventilation - check  
Special tools and workshop equipment required  
♦ Vacuum pump -VAG 1390- or Vacuum pump -VAS 6213-  
2.3.1  
Test conditions  
The ignition must be off.

2.3.2  
Test sequence  
– Remove the regeneration flexible hose-1- from the activated  
charcoal filter in the electromagnetic valve 1 of the activated  
charcoal filter -N80 - -2-.  
– Install the Vacuum pump -VAG 1390- or Vacuum pump -VAS  
6213- as illustrated, the flexible hose-1-.  
– Operate the Vacuum pump -VAG 1390- or Vacuum pump -  
VAS 6213 - several times. No vacuum can be generated.  
If vacuum is generated:  
– Check the ventilation opening -3- in the lower part of the acti‐  
vated charcoal filter -4- for impurities and, if necessary, clean  
it.  
If vacuum is not generated:  
– Cover the ventilation opening -3- and operate the Vacuum  
pump -VAG 1390- or Vacuum pump -VAS 6213 - several times  
again. Vacuum has to be generated.  
If vacuum is not generated:  
– Replace the activated charcoal filter.
